Unlock instant, AI-driven research and patent intelligence for your innovation.

Method and system for decoding exponential Columbus code, electronic equipment and storage medium

A decoding method and index technology, applied in the field of computer-readable storage media, can solve problems such as long delay and large-area overhead, and achieve the effect of reducing overhead and delay

Active Publication Date: 2021-09-17
INSPUR SUZHOU INTELLIGENT TECH CO LTD
View PDF4 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] Existing exponential Columbus decoders usually use a hard lookup table to decode leading zeros, which will bring large area overhead and long delay

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and system for decoding exponential Columbus code, electronic equipment and storage medium
  • Method and system for decoding exponential Columbus code, electronic equipment and storage medium
  • Method and system for decoding exponential Columbus code, electronic equipment and stor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0043] The following will clearly and completely describe the technical solutions in the embodiments of the application with reference to the drawings in the embodiments of the application. Apparently, the described embodiments are only some of the embodiments of the application, not all of them. Based on the embodiments in this application, all other embodiments obtained by persons of ordinary skill in the art without creative efforts fall within the protection scope of this application.

[0044] The embodiment of the present application discloses an exponential Golomb code decoding method, which reduces the overhead and time delay of exponential Golomb code decoding.

[0045] see figure 1 , a flow chart of an Exponential Golomb code decoding method shown according to an exemplary embodiment, such as figure 1 shown, including:

[0046] S101: Obtain the bit stream of the exponential-Golomb code to be decoded, and determine the starting position in the bit stream as the targe...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The present application discloses a method and system for decoding an Exponential Columbus code, an electronic device and a computer-readable storage medium. The method includes: obtaining the bit stream of the Exponential Colomb code to be decoded, and sequentially converting the bits in the bit stream from the starting position to The bit is determined as the target bit, and the operation corresponding to the target bit is performed; wherein, the operation includes: judging whether the identification of the operation conforms to the coding rules of the Exponential Golomb code; wherein, the identification of the operation is from the starting position to the bit corresponding to the operation If so, output the decoding result corresponding to the operation; among them, the decoding result is the target decimal value minus one, the target decimal value is the decimal value corresponding to the target binary value, and the target binary value is the status flag; if not, execute The operation corresponding to the next bit of the target bit reduces the overhead and time delay of exponential Golomb code decoding.

Description

technical field [0001] The present application relates to the technical field of multimedia video processing, and more specifically, relates to an Exponential Golomb code decoding method and system, an electronic device, and a computer-readable storage medium. Background technique [0002] Exponential Columbus code is a special kind of Huffman code, its essence is that the probability of the encoded signal being 0 is at least 1 / 2, and the sum of the probabilities of 1 and 2 accounts for at least 1 / 2 of the remaining probabilities, so that analogy. The Exponential Columbus code is a variable-length code, and the code length is dynamically determined by the content of its code word. [0003] Existing exponential Golomb decoders usually use a hard look-up table to decode leading zeros, which will bring a large area overhead and a long delay. [0004] Therefore, how to reduce the overhead and time delay of exponential Golomb code decoding is a technical problem to be solved by...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): H04N19/91H04N19/184H04N19/44
CPCH04N19/184H04N19/44H04N19/91
Inventor 李灯伟刘金广
Owner INSPUR SUZHOU INTELLIGENT TECH CO LTD